Description
The City of Fayetteville, Arkansas is seeking bids from qualified bidders for the removal and recycling of scrap metal. The contract is estimated to cover approximately 200 tons annually and will be for one year with up to four automatic one-year renewals. Bidders must submit their bids by July 14th, 2026, before 2:00 PM local time, either electronically or by sealed physical bid. The City encourages small, minority, and women business enterprises to participate and subcontract portions of the contract.
